We don't have a persistent fb holding a reference to the frontbuffer
object, so every time we do the get+put we throw the frontbuffer object
immediately away. And so the next time around we get a pristine
frontbuffer object with bits==0 even for the old vma. This confuses
the frontbuffer tracking code which understandably expects the old
frontbuffer to have the overlay's bit set.
Fix this by hanging on to the frontbuffer reference until the next
flip. And just to make this a bit more clear let's track the frontbuffer
explicitly instead of just grabbing it via the old vma.

ilk+ planes get notably unhappy when the plane x+w exceeds
the stride. This wasn't a problem previously because we
always aligned SURF to the closest tile boundary so the
x offset never got particularly large. But now with async
flips we have to align to 256KiB instead and thus this
becomes a real issue.
On ilk/snb/ivb it looks like the accesses just wrap
early to the next tile row when scanout goes past the
SURF+n*stride boundary, hsw/bdw suffer more heavily and
start to underrun constantly. i965/g4x appear to be immune.
vlv/chv I've not yet checked.
Let's borrow another trick from the skl+ code and search
backwards for a better SURF offset in the hopes of getting the
x offset below the limit. IIRC when I ran into a similar issue
on skl years ago it was causing the hardware to fall over
pretty hard as well.
And let's be consistent and include i965/g4x in the check
as well, just in case I just got super lucky somehow when
I wasn't able to reproduce the issue. Not that it really
matters since we still use 4k SURF alignment for i965/g4x
anyway.

The TypeC FIA can be powered down if the TC-COLD power state is allowed,
so block the TC-COLD state when initializing the FIA.
Note that this isn't needed on ICL where the FIA is never modular and
which has no generic way to block TC-COLD (except for platforms with a
legacy TypeC port and on those too only via these legacy ports, not via
a DP-alt/TBT port).

The BXT/GLK DPLL can't generate certain frequencies. We already
reject the 233-240MHz range on both. But on GLK the DPLL max
frequency was bumped from 300MHz to 594MHz, so now we get to
also worry about the 446-480MHz range (double the original
problem range). Reject any frequency within the higher
problematic range as well.

Enabling atomic operations in L3 leads to unrecoverable GPU hangs, as
the machine stops responding milliseconds after receipt of the reset
request [GDRT]. By disabling the cached atomics, the hang do not occur
and we presume the GPU would reset normally for similar hangs.
Sadly this is a shotgun approach, but since the impact is critical it is
better to err on the safe side and work back from there.

Smatch found an uninitialized variable bug in this code:
drivers/gpu/drm/i915/gvt/cmd_parser.c:3191 intel_gvt_update_reg_whitelist()
error: uninitialized symbol 'ret'.
The first thing that Smatch complains about is that "ret" isn't set if
we don't enter the "for_each_engine(engine, &dev_priv->gt, id) {" loop.
Presumably we always have at least one engine so that's a false
positive.
But it's definitely a bug to not set "ret" if i915_gem_object_pin_map()
fails.
Let's fix the bug and silence the false positive.

While JSL and EHL eDP transcoder supports PSR2, the phy of this
platforms only supports eDP 1.3, so removing PSR2 support as this
feature was added in eDP 1.4.

At least on some TGL platforms PUNIT wants to access some display HW
registers, but it doesn't handle display power management (disabling DC
states as required) and so this register access will lead to a hang. To
prevent this disable runtime power management for poweroff and reboot.

The DP PHY vswing/pre-emphasis level programming the driver does is
related to the DPTX -> first LTTPR link segment only. Accordingly it
should be only programmed when link training the first LTTPR and kept
as-is when training subsequent LTTPRs and the DPRX. For these latter
PHYs the vs/pe levels will be set in response to writing the
DP_TRAINING_LANEx_SET_PHY_REPEATERy DPCD registers (by an upstream LTTPR
TX PHY snooping this write access of its downstream LTTPR/DPRX RX PHY).
The above is also described in DP Standard v2.0 under 3.6.6.1.
While at it simplify and add the LTTPR that is link trained to the debug
message in intel_dp_set_signal_levels().
